Ruling the Pop World
Blüchen's journey started way back in 1995 when she was just 15. Before ya know it, she became one of the biggest pop stars in Germany. Her unique voice and infectious dance beats had the country groovin' and shakin'.
After her first retirement in the early 2000s, she released tracks under her own name and even dabbled in acting and hostin'. Then, in 2019, she made a big comeback as everyone's favorite Blüchen. Since then, she's kept the dance parties goin' strong, performin' her hit tunes on stage. In 2021, she dropped her sixth studio album, again under her civilian name Jasmin Wagner. And in 2024, she dropped THE hit we've all been waitin' for, "Ravergirl."
Off stage, Blüchen's been married twice and welcomed a daughter in November 2022. Now that she's finally hangin' up the mic, she'll have more time to focus on her loved ones. "Music's been my ride-or-die throughout my life - now I say thanks for 30 incredible years and a journey way prettier than I ever dared to dream," she added.
